suitable maternity shoot gowns is essential to ensure you feel comfortable and
look stunning in your maternity photos. Here are some tips to help you select
the perfect maternity gowns for your photoshoot:
1. Start Early: - Begin your search for maternity gowns well
in advance of your photoshoot date to allow time for fittings and alterations
if needed.
2. Consider Your
Style: -Every pregnant woman's photoshoot should be
unique and customized. So, you better consider the style and theme you want for your maternity
photos. Do you prefer a romantic, classic, bohemian, or casual look? Choose
gowns that align with your style vision.
3. Prioritize
Comfort: -Comfort should be a top priority during your
maternity photoshoot. Look for gowns made from soft, breathable, and stretchy
fabrics that accommodate your growing belly.
4. Size Matters: - Maternity gowns are typically designed to fit a range of sizes, so
choose your pre-pregnancy size. Read product descriptions carefully to ensure a
good fit.
5. Length and Train: - Decide on the length of your gown. Full-length gowns can create a
dramatic effect, while shorter gowns can be more playful. Consider whether you
want a gown with a train for added elegance.
6. Neckline and
Sleeves: - Choose a neckline and sleeve style that
complements your body shape and personal preferences. Options include
off-shoulder, scoop neck, V-neck, and various sleeve lengths.
7. Color Palette: - Consider the colour palette you want for your photos. White and pastel
shades are classic choices, but you can also opt for bold or earthy tones that
suit your style and the location of the shoot. Even when planning your couple's pregnancy
photoshoot,
don’t forget to match the colour of your attire with your partner.
8. Flowing Fabrics: - Gowns with flowing fabrics, such as chiffon or tulle, can create
beautiful, ethereal effects in your photos as they catch the breeze.
9. Season Aligned
Dress: -Take into account the season in which your photoshoot
will occur. Choose lighter fabrics for summer and warmer, layered gowns for
winter shoots.
10. Accentuate Your
Bump: -Look
for gowns that have empire waistlines or waistbands above your baby bump to
accentuate your pregnancy silhouette.
11. Try Before You
Buy: - If
possible, try on the gowns before purchasing or order from a retailer with a
good return policy. This ensures the gown fits well and is comfortable.
12. Rent or Buy: - Consider whether you want to buy a gown
that you can keep as a memento or rent one for the photoshoot.
13. Accessorize: - Remember to accessorize to complete your
look. This could include flower crowns, maternity sashes, or statement jewelry.
14. Consult with
Your Photographer: -
Discuss your gown choices with your photographer to ensure they complement the
chosen location and style of the maternity
photoshoot.
15. Have Backup
Options: -
Bring a backup gown or outfit in case of any unexpected issues, such as a
wardrobe malfunction or a change in weather.
Selecting maternity shoot gowns that align
with your style, Comfort, and the overall theme of your photoshoot will result
in stunning and memorable pregnancy photos. Be sure to communicate with your
photographer about your gown choices to ensure they can capture your vision
effectively.
